CManT1914 said:
Can you elaborate on this? I have a 94 GT convertible, and would like to know if I can "fix" the foglights to where they come on with just the park lights at least. I hate having to have the driving lights on for them to come on.
Click to expand...

If it's a coupe....just pull the fog light switch and in the hole there is a harness layin free for the convertible top (since all have the same harness), and one of those wires on the convertible top harness has constant power when the car is in ACC or RUN. The mod will give you fogs independantly w/o the other lights.

You need to do a search and find the link for it.
Ill post it if I can find it though!

EDIT: Just saw your sig...BUT I think you can still do it this way....just don't have the fogs on when you open/close the top....since it might be too much to run at the same time.
